Output 81c938f801dd15ecd0efcf6c2fa19fce9dabc53907c4e30daae10b7b7ca6507a:0

value
41093000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bb34e987eb0b52fa3b86b20e457848d7f1261d OP_EQUAL
address
3MSz9KyCkSZPrZe12MAECMve31LnQXwpVJ
transaction
81c938f801dd15ecd0efcf6c2fa19fce9dabc53907c4e30daae10b7b7ca6507a
spent
true